The Throne Address, delivered by His Majesty King Mohammed VI on the occasion of the 27th anniversary of his accession to the throne of his illustrious ancestors, reflects the royal strategy aimed at consolidating Morocco’s position in a rapidly competitive global economy.
This address is part of a long-term vision that has guided Morocco’s development over the past few years, as highlighted by Dr. Mohamed Daâdaoui, a renowned expert on Moroccan politics and an American-Moroccan scholar.
The Throne Address is more than just a recap of achievements; it illustrates a model of Moroccan development based on long-term planning, efficient implementation, and sustained investment, while also consolidating a broader approach to governance that has contributed to Morocco’s stability and security.
Dr. Daâdaoui emphasizes that the King’s address focused on key sectors such as cutting-edge industries, renewable energy, aerospace, defense industries, and resilient supply chains, with the goal of equipping Morocco with the necessary tools to enhance its position in a global economy facing numerous challenges.
The strategy outlined by the kingdom for addressing future challenges is based on a more diversified national economy driven by innovation, industrial growth, and technological progress.
